About Brex Court

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

Brex Court is a one-bedroom mid-terrace house in Leicester (LE3 6NE). It has a recorded floor area of 35 m² (around 377 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 1950-1966. At 35 m² this is the 2nd smallest of 4 units on EPC record in Brex Court, where floor areas span 34–45 m². The building's EPC ratings span D to C, with this unit at the top. On EPC score it ranks first in the building (72 versus a worst of 67). The latest certificate (August 2019) shows a C (score 72).

Across 1996–2017, sale prices on this property compounded at 2.1%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£115,000 sits 187.5% above the 2017 sale of £40,000. At 35 m² it sits well below the postcode median (83 m² across 41 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. On the market in December 2017 and unlisted since — roughly 8 years.
